Vibert radio interview 2004
by Guest Betty- 3 replies
- 1k views
I was in the downloads yesterday and I got the Triple J interview with the live DJ set, I had previously assumed that this was the same as what I had recorded off the local radio back then. However, it turns out that this is a different Triple J interview and live set to that, so I'm offering it up here to be included in the downloads section (does CATS do that anymore!?). The 20 minute live set excerpt features Aphex and Vibert mixing/jamming over each other with their laptops synced up.
